";
if ($id_evenement!=NULL){
$res = spip_query("SELECT evenements.* FROM spip_evenements AS evenements WHERE evenements.id_evenement="._q($id_evenement));
if ($row = spip_fetch_array($res)){
if (!isset($neweven)){
$fid_evenement=$row['id_evenement'];
$ftitre=attribut_html(typo($row['titre']));
$flieu=attribut_html(typo($row['lieu']));
$fhoraire=attribut_html($row['horaire']);
$fdescriptif=attribut_html(typo($row['descriptif']));
$fstdatedeb=strtotime($row['date_debut']);
$fstdatefin=strtotime($row['date_fin']);
$fid_evenement_source=$row['id_evenement_source'];
}
}
$res2 = spip_query("SELECT articles.* FROM spip_articles AS articles LEFT JOIN spip_evenements AS J ON J.id_article=articles.id_article WHERE J.id_evenement="._q($id_evenement));
if ($row2 = spip_fetch_array($res2)){
$out .= "
\n";
}
$out .= "";
$url=self();
$url=parametre_url($url,'edit','');
$url=parametre_url($url,'neweven','');
$url=parametre_url($url,'del','');
$url=parametre_url($url,'id_evenement','');
$out .= "
";
$out .= "";
$out .= "
\n";
$fobjet = entites_html($fobjet,ENT_QUOTES);
$flieu = entites_html($flieu,ENT_QUOTES);
$fdescription = entites_html($fdescription,ENT_QUOTES);
$out .= "";
$out .= _T('agenda:evenement_titre');
$out .= "
$ftitre
\n";
$out .= "";
$out .= _T('agenda:evenement_lieu');
$out .= "
$flieu
\n";
$out .= "
";
$out .= "";
$out .= _T('agenda:evenement_date');
$out .= "
";
$out .= "";
$out .= _T('agenda:evenement_date_du');
$out .= " ".affdate_jourcourt(date("Y-m-d H:i",$fstdatedeb))." ";
if ($fhoraire=='oui')
$out .= _T('agenda:evenement_date_a_immediat');
$out .= " ".date("H:i",$fstdatedeb);
$out .= "
\n";
$out .= _T('agenda:evenement_date_au');
$out .= " ".affdate_jourcourt(date("Y-m-d H:i",$fstdatefin))." ";
if ($fhoraire=='oui')
$out .= _T('agenda:evenement_date_a_immediat');
$out .= " ".date("H:i",$fstdatefin);
$out .= "
\n";
$out .= "
\n";
$out .= "";
$out .= _T('agenda:evenement_descriptif');
$out .= "
$fdescriptif
\n";
$out .= "";
$res = spip_query("SELECT * FROM spip_groupes_mots WHERE evenements='oui' ORDER BY titre");
$sep = "";
while ($row = spip_fetch_array($res,SPIP_ASSOC)){
$id_groupe = $row['id_groupe'];
$row2 = spip_fetch_array(
spip_query("SELECT mots.titre FROM spip_mots_evenements AS mots_evenements
LEFT JOIN spip_mots AS mots ON mots.id_mot=mots_evenements.id_mot
WHERE mots.id_groupe="._q($id_groupe).
" AND mots_evenements.id_evenement="._q($id_evenement)));
if ($row2){
$out .= $sep . supprimer_numero($row['titre'])." : ".supprimer_numero($row2['titre']);
$sep = "\n, ";
}
}
$out .= "
\n";
$url = parametre_url(self(),'annee','');
$url = parametre_url($url,'mois','');
$url = parametre_url($url,'jour','');
$out .= "";
$id_source = $fid_evenement_source?$fid_evenement_source:$id_evenement;
$res2 = spip_query("SELECT * FROM spip_evenements WHERE id_evenement="._q($id_source)." OR id_evenement_source="._q($id_source)." ORDER BY date_debut");
if (spip_num_rows($res2)>1){
$out .= _T('agenda:evenement_autres_occurences');
while($row2 = spip_fetch_array($res2)){
if ($row2['id_evenement']!=$fid_evenement){
$url = parametre_url(self(),'id_evenement',$row2['id_evenement']);
$out .= "
" . affdate_jourcourt($row2['date_debut']) ."";
}
}
}
$out .= "
";
if ($fid_evenement_source!=0){
$res2 = spip_query("SELECT evenements.* FROM spip_evenements AS evenements WHERE evenements.id_evenement="._q($fid_evenement_source));
if ($row2 = spip_fetch_array($res2)){
$url = parametre_url($url,'id_evenement',$row2['id_evenement']);
$out .= "";
}
}
else if ($flag_editable){
$url=self();
$url=parametre_url($url,'edit','');
$url=parametre_url($url,'neweven','');
$url=parametre_url($url,'del','');
$url=parametre_url($url,'id_evenement','');
$form = "";
if ($del==1) { //---------------Suppression RDV ------------------------------
//$out .= "";
}
else {
$url=parametre_url($url,'id_evenement',$id_evenement);
$url=parametre_url($url,'edit',1);
//$out .= "";
}
$args = explode('?',parametre_url($url,'exec','','&'));
$out .= ajax_action_auteur('voir_evenement',"0-voir","calendrier",end($args),$form,'','wc_init');
}
}
$out .= "";
return $out;
}
?>